The Early Pioneers

The seeds of female comedy in America were sown in the early 20th century with the likes of Fanny Brice, the "Funny Girl" of vaudeville. With her quick-witted banter and infectious personality, Brice paved the way for future female performers. Mae West, the "Sex Goddess," followed suit, challenging societal norms with her provocative humor and racy stage presence.

The Golden Age of Television

The advent of television in the 1950s and 1960s ushered in a golden age for women in comedy. Lucille Ball, the iconic star of "I Love Lucy," became America's beloved sitcom queen. Her physical comedy and comedic timing set the standard for generations of comediennes. Carol Burnett, another comedy legend, showcased her versatility and quick wit in her groundbreaking variety show.

The Stand-up Revolution

In the 1970s, the comedy club scene exploded, providing a platform for women to break free from traditional gender roles and tell their own unique stories. Joan Rivers, the "Queen of Insult Comedy," fearlessly tore into celebrities and audiences alike with her sharp tongue. Phyllis Diller, the "First Lady of American Comedy," delivered hilarious monologues filled with self-deprecating humor and quirky observations.

Contemporary Trailblazers

Today, the legacy of these pioneering women continues to inspire a new generation of hysterical comediennes. Amy Schumer, known for her fearless and raw comedy, has become a household name. Tina Fey, the creator of "30 Rock," has redefined female-led comedy with her sharp writing and deadpan delivery. Melissa McCarthy, the star of "Bridesmaids," has proven that physical comedy is not just for men.
